Try and do the pull in 4th gear. 3rd gear min. Start from a low "Boggy" RPM. 1st and second gear pulls are going to be hard to record. Also, looks like you might have a Vac- leak or low compression. Is the engine Ported? Also if you don't hold the gas all the way down... you won't get an accurate reading. When you do the pulls. Step on the Gas pedal 100%. Looking at your TPS..you let off a bit here and there. Good luck brotha! hope that helped a lil at least!
